US Embassy Donates Vehicles to Somalia’s Judicial Institutions

Storyline:National News

GOOBJOOG NEWS | MOGADISHU: The United States Embassy in Mogadishu has donated three vehicles to Somalia’s Judicial Training Institute, the South West State Office of the Attorney General, and the Hirshabelle Office of the Attorney General.  

This donation is part of the ongoing support from the United States to Somalia, specifically through the State Department’s Bureau of International Narcotics and Law Enforcement Affairs (INL) and its Somalia Justice Support Program (SOMJUST).

Speaking during the handover ceremony in Mogadishu, U.S. Charge d’Affaires Dixon highlighted the crucial role played by judicial officials in Somalia and their contribution to fighting crime and terrorism.

The United States, through INL, has committed nearly $70 million over eight years to support Somalia’s justice, police, maritime security, and corrections sectors through training, equipment, and operational support, demonstrating a continued investment in Somalia’s judicial reforms and sustainable development.  

The attorney general offices in Jubaland, Puntland, and Galmudug will also each receive a vehicle in the near future as part of the support.
